Cuisine in Quang Dong is particularly renowned for its grilled dishes, including chicken, duck, and other meats. These dishes emphasize four main elements: aroma, color, taste, and shape, demanding precision for each dish: tender but not raw, fresh but not coarse, fatty but not greasy, savory but not bland. Spring and summer dishes should be refreshing, while autumn and winter dishes should be warm and rich in flavor.
The honey glazed chicken I want to introduce today also comes from this culinary style. The chicken is marinated according to traditional Chinese recipes and coated with a layer of honey glaze. The tender and flavorful chicken meat combined with crispy, sweet skin offers a memorable taste experience. It's a perfect dish for year-end parties or entertaining friends.
PREPARATION OF INGREDIENTS FOR QUANG DONG HONEY GLAZED CHICKEN
- 1 whole chicken, about 3kg, head and feet removed
- 1kg potatoes
- A few sprigs of green garlic
- 3-4 pieces of dried tangerine peel
For the marinade:
- 60ml soy sauce, 3 tablespoons Hoisin sauce, 4 cloves minced garlic, 1 tablespoon minced shallots, 2 tablespoons minced fresh ginger, 1½ tablespoons salt, 3 tablespoons Shaoxing wine, 1 teaspoon Chinese five-spice powder.
For the honey glaze:
- ⅓ cup hot water, 2 tablespoons vinegar, 3 tablespoons honey

GUIDE TO MAKING QUANG DONG HONEY GLAZED CHICKEN
Step 1. Prepare the marinade
Make the sauce by mixing the sauce ingredients together. Mix until well combined.


Step 2. Marinate the chicken
Rub the chicken inside out with the sauce, ensuring all surfaces are thoroughly coated. Place the dried tangerine peel inside the chicken cavity along with any remaining sauce.
Place the chicken on a tray, wrap tightly with plastic wrap, and refrigerate overnight. The next day, remove the chicken from the fridge 1 hour before cooking to bring it to room temperature.

Step 3. Prepare the baking tray
When you're ready to cook, line the baking tray with sliced potatoes and minced garlic.

Place the chicken on top, tucking the thighs underneath.

Step 4. Roast the chicken
Roast the chicken in the oven at 220°C for 15 minutes. Then, use a brush to coat the chicken with honey mixture and return it to the baking tray. Roast for an additional 15 minutes.

Take the chicken out of the oven, flip it over. Brush honey onto the chicken. Reduce the oven temperature to 160°C and roast for about 10 more minutes, brushing with honey again. Roast for another 10 minutes until done.

Step 5. Presentation
Transfer the chicken to a plate, cover with aluminum foil, and let it rest for 15 minutes.
Remove the potatoes and garlic from the pan. You can leave them whole or mash them into delicious roasted mashed potatoes (just add milk, butter, and salt to taste).

Strain the vegetable broth from the tray. Serve in a small bowl alongside the chicken.
